Description
STTR Phase Phase I award: "Rapid Identification of Aerosol Particles: Electrochemical Characterization Infused with Machine Learning" awarded to THE PROBITAS PROJECT, INC. in VIENNA, Virginia. Funded by Department of Defense (Office for Chemical and Biological Defense). Award amount: $209,574.83. The SBIR/STTR programs fund innovative research and development by small businesses, with Phase I for feasibility studies and Phase II for full R&D.
